Aljoya on Mercer Island is a beautiful facility located in the heart of town, especially convenient for seniors who like to walk to nearby shops, parks, and the waterfront. Our own restaurant and coffee area provide good service and opportunity for association with other residents and visitors, a welcome alternative to the lonesomeness that so often comes with aging. There is opportunity for singing, games, including boccie, swimming, exercise, and trips, It is great to not have to worry about the plumbing, maintenance, and other problems so common in most homes. (Even as I write this a plumbing problem is being fixed within a few hours of my report to the front desk.) I doubt that there are many if any better alternatives for retirement!
